Key Points:

  • Jonathan Andic, son of Mango founder Isak Andic, has been arrested for the alleged murder of his father, who died during a hiking trip in Montserrat, Catalonia, in December 2024.
  • Isak Andic's death was initially considered a tragic accident after he reportedly fell 150 meters off a cliff, but inconsistencies in Jonathan's statements prompted a deeper investigation.
  • Reports suggest a tense relationship between father and son, including a serious argument shortly before Isak Andic's death.
  • Jonathan Andic serves as vice-chairman of Mango's board and is expected to appear before a judge soon in Martorell.
  • Isak Andic, born in Istanbul in 1953, built Mango into a major global fashion empire after moving to Catalonia as a teenager and starting in street markets.
